    Lynx7386 wrote: »
    Think I'm going to try dw maces for the extra armor pen, since I'm lacking that from gear

    1h weapon type was also something I was thinking about, but I decided against maces for PvE because it's a % bonus against enemy resistance. And if I remember correctly, NPC enemies tend to have much smaller resistances than players seem to, so when combined with Sharpened and my gear (running 5 Toothrow, 5 NMG, and 2 Kraghs), that extra penetration seems like a very poor bonus compared to the crit increase from daggers.

    So I would say that if you are considering maces, make sure to calculate what your overall penetration is beforehand to see if you actually need that increase or not.

    Lynx7386 wrote: »
    Think I'm going to try dw maces for the extra armor pen, since I'm lacking that from gear

    Don't. The long and short of it is if you don't have major fracture on the target, mauls/maces are better, if major fracture is on the target, mauls/maces and swords are about even, if you have anymore debuffs, IE NMG, alkosh, even a crusher enchant, swords are better.

    Note that the debuffs are skills that benefit the whole group, so armor sets like TFS and spriggan and kraghs are calculated after mauls/maces percentages, as is sharpened.

    And on a sorc, as I have said it is quite important to crit, more consistent crits mean more heals. So daggers are really the only option.

    If you're new to the class or dont have BiS gear - 2 daggers is always preferable.
    If you're running top tier gear and are fluent with the class, then 1 dagger 1 axe is usually best for DPS. All things being equal.

    For PvE BiS would be something like:
    5 pc 2-Fanged, 2 pc Velidreth , 3 pc VO, and 1 maelstrom dagger, 1 maelstrom axe, both sharpened. With Maelstrom bow back bar, also sharpened.

    On my stamsorc I run 2 sharpened maelstrom daggers though, since the best maelstrom axes I've managed to loot are precise and nirnhoned. So my input here is theoretical since I haven't tested them directly.
